The St. John's Folk Arts Council

presents


How to Play Traditional
Music on the Tin Whistle


with whistle wizard

Gerry Strong




In our ongoing series of day-long workshops promoting the traditional performing arts of Newfoundland and Labrador, we're ecstatic to have Gerry Strong facilitating this workshop!

photo by Rick West Gerry has been involved with countless folk bands, and has played as a session musician on innumerable recordings. As a long time member of the seminal traditional band Tickle Harbour, Gerry gained a reputation as a world class tin whistle/flute player (among other things!!).

The tin whistle...we know it's cheap, but is it easy?? Gerry will talk a little about the technicalities involved in playing the ultimate portable instrument. Clear tone, breathing, and ornamentation are topics that will be touched upon, as well as repertoire, and information on the types of whistles available.

...and yes, you will learn to play a tune!
